About (9aR)-6-methyl-7-oxo-9a-phenyl-3-(1-pyridin-3-ylpyrazol-4-yl)-4,5,5a,6-tetrahydro-1H-benzo[g]indazole-8-carbonitrile

(9aR)-6-methyl-7-oxo-9a-phenyl-3-(1-pyridin-3-ylpyrazol-4-yl)-4,5,5a,6-tetrahydro-1H-benzo[g]indazole-8-carbonitrile (PubChem CID 118257662) has the molecular formula C27H22N6O and a molecular weight of 446.51 g/mol. Its IUPAC name is (9aR)-6-methyl-7-oxo-9a-phenyl-3-(1-pyridin-3-ylpyrazol-4-yl)-4,5,5a,6-tetrahydro-1H-benzo[g]indazole-8-carbonitrile.
